WebThe generation in between, generation X, occasionally get a look-in. But the youngest generation, generation Z, are almost entirely ignored. That’s partly because they’re still young: generation Z was born from the mid-1990s to the late 2000s, so the majority of this generation is still under the age of 18. Web2 days ago · The world is likely to have seen ‘peak emissions’ from power generation in 2024, with wind and solar-led electrification set to squeeze down fossil-fired electricity from now on, research group Ember said. The energy think-tank claimed “a new era of falling power sector emissions is very close” as it said clean generation expansion is ...
